Cajun Sausage and Potatoes Recipe Delight

Introduction

If you’re in the mood for a dish that captures the essence of Southern comfort food, then this andouille sausage with red potatoes is sure to satisfy. The combination of smoky sausage and tender potatoes, seasoned with Cajun spices, creates a hearty meal that’s perfect for any night of the week.

Detailed Ingredients with measures

1 lb andouille sausage, sliced
2 tbsp vegetable oil
1½ lbs red potatoes, cut into bite-sized pieces
8 oz package frozen chopped green peppers and onions
½ tbsp Cajun seasoning
1 tsp salt
1 tsp black pepper

Prep Time

10 minutes

Cook Time, Total Time, Yield

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 30 minutes
Yield: Serves 4

Instructions

1. Heat 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il over medium heat.
2. Add the sliced sausage and sauté until browned.
3. Remove the sausage from the pan and add the remaining oil.
4. Place the red potatoes and frozen peppers and onions in the pan.
5. Season with Cajun seasoning, salt, and black pepper.
6. Cover the pan and cook for 10 minutes, stirring occasionally.
7. When the potatoes have softened, remove the lid and add the sausage back to the pan.
8. Continue cooking for 5 to 10 minutes, stirring often.
9. When the potatoes have begun to brown on the outside, remove from heat and serve immediately.

Notes

Note 1

Adjust the amount of Cajun seasoning according to your personal taste preference if you want more or less spice.

Note 2

For added flavor, you can incorporate other vegetables such as diced tomatoes or corn.

Note 3

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at on the stovetop or microwave before serving.

Cook techniques

Sautéing

Sautéing is a cooking technique where ingredients are cooked quickly in a small amount of oil over medium to high heat. In this recipe, slicing the andouille sausage and sautéing it until browned enhances its flavor and texture.

Covering to Steam

Covering the pan while cooking the red potatoes and frozen peppers and onions helps to trap steam, which accelerates cooking and ensures the potatoes soften evenly. This method is particularly useful when working with ingredients that require different cooking times.

Stirring

Stirring the ingredients occasionally while they cook is essential to prevent sticking and ensure even cooking. In this recipe, stirring helps distribute heat and allows the seasoning to evenly coat the vegetables and sausage.

Returning Ingredients to the Pan

Adding the browned sausage back into the pan after the potatoes have softened allows the flavors to meld together. This technique enhances the dish’s overall taste and ensures that the sausage is heated through before serving.

Browning

Browning the potatoes at the end of cooking adds an appealing texture and flavor. This final step creates a delicious, slightly crispy exterior that contrasts with the soft interior of the potatoes, enhancing the dish’s overall presentation and taste.

FAQ

Can I use another type of sausage instead of andouille?

Yes, you can substitute andouille sausage with other types of sausage, such as Italian sausage, kielbasa, or chicken sausage, depending on your preference.

How do I know when the potatoes are done cooking?

The potatoes are done when they are soft throughout and easily pierced with a fork. For an added texture, you can cook them a little longer until they begin to brown on the outside.

What can I serve with this dish?

This dish can be served as a standalone meal or paired with a side salad, cornbread, or steamed vegetables for a more balanced meal.

Can I make this recipe vegetarian?

Yes, you can make this recipe vegetarian by omitting the sausage and using a plant-based sausage alternative and vegetable broth for added flavor.

How should I store leftovers?

Leftovers should be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the microwave or on the stovetop until heated through before serving.
